The City Recorder, at the request of, or with the concurrence of the <br /> <br />City Attorney, is authorized to administratively correct any reference errors contained <br /> <br />herein or in other provisions of the Eugene Code, 1971, to the provisions added, <br /> <br />amended or repealed herein. <br /> <br />Section 4. Within two years from the effective date of this Ordinance: (1) the City <br /> <br />Manager shall prepare a report of the activity recorded in the Downtown Public Safety <br /> <br />Zone and provide that report to the Police Commission; and (2) the Police Commission <br /> <br />shall review the report, obtain public input regarding the effectiveness of this Ordinance <br /> <br />in reducing targeted incidents in the Downtown Public Safety Zone and provide a <br /> <br />recommendation to the Council regarding continued enforcement of this Ordinance. <br /> <br />Section 5. Unless otherwise extended by the City Council, this Ordinance and the <br /> <br />amendments authorized herein shall automatically sunset and be repealed August 11, <br /> <br />2010.
